Because chemicals are toxic, they are additionally potentially dangerous to human beings, pets, other microorganisms, and the environment. For that reason, people who use chemicals or consistently come in contact with them need to recognize the loved one poisoning, prospective health and wellness results, and preventative steps to reduce exposure to the items they utilize. Threat, or threat, of making use of chemicals is the potential for injury, or the degree of risk entailed in making use of a chemical under an offered collection of problems.

The poisoning of a certain chemical is established by subjecting examination animals to varying dosages of the energetic ingredient (a.i.) and each of its formulated products. The energetic ingredient is the chemical part in the chemical item that controls the pest. By comprehending the difference in toxicity levels of pesticides, a customer can lessen the possible threat by choosing the chemical with the cheapest toxicity that will certainly control the parasite.


Applicators can lessen or almost eliminate direct exposure-- and thus decrease danger-- by complying with the label instructions, using individual protective clothing and devices (PPE), and dealing with the chemical correctly. For instance, greater than 95 percent of all pesticide exposures come from facial direct exposure, largely to the hands and lower arms. By wearing a set of unlined, chemical-resistant handwear covers, this kind of exposure can be virtually gotten rid of.


The hazardous impacts that take place from a single direct exposure by any path of entrance are called "severe results." The 4 routes of exposure are facial (skin), inhalation (lungs), oral (mouth), and the eyes. Intense toxicity is established by checking out the dermal toxicity, breathing toxicity, and dental poisoning of examination pets.

Acute poisoning is measured as the amount or focus of a toxicant-- the a.i.-- needed to kill 50 percent of the animals in an examination population. This measure is normally revealed as the LD50 (dangerous dosage 50) or the LC50 (lethal concentration 50). In addition, the LD50 and LC50 values are based on a single dose and are recorded in milligrams of pesticide per kg of body weight (mg/kg) of the guinea pig or in components per million (ppm).


The reduced the LD50 or LC50 worth of a chemical item, the greater its poisoning to humans and pets. Pesticides with a high LD50 are the least poisonous to humans if used according to the directions on the product label. The persistent toxicity of a chemical is determined by subjecting examination pets to long-term exposure to the energetic ingredient.


The chronic toxicity of a chemical is harder than intense poisoning to establish via lab evaluation. Products are categorized on the basis of their loved one severe poisoning (their LD50 or LC50 worths). Pesticides that are identified as very hazardous (Toxicity Category I) on the basis of either dental, dermal, or inhalation toxicity have to have the signal words DANGER and POISON published in red with a skull and crossbones sign prominently displayed on the front panel of the plan tag.




The intense (solitary dose) dental LD50 for pesticide products in this group varies from a trace quantity to 50 mg/kg. Direct exposure of a couple of declines of a product taken orally could be fatal to a 150-pound person. https://www.metal-archives.com/users/ecobedbug3xt. Some chemical items have just the signal word threat, which informs you absolutely nothing concerning the severe poisoning, just that the item can trigger extreme eye damages or serious skin irritation

The signs of pesticide poisoning can vary from a mild skin irritability to coma or perhaps death.


Since of possible health and wellness problems, chemical customers and trainers should recognize the usual indications and signs and symptoms of chemical poisoning. The impacts, or signs and symptoms, of chemical poisoning can be extensively specified as either topical or systemic.

Dermatitis, or inflammation of the skin, is accepted as the most commonly reported topical effect connected with official source chemical exposure. Some people tend to cough, wheeze, or sneeze when subjected to pesticide sprays.




This signs and symptom usually subsides within a couple of mins after an individual is gotten rid of from the direct exposure to the irritant. Nevertheless, a reaction to a pesticide item that creates somebody not just to sneeze and cough yet also to establish severe acute respiratory system symptoms is more most likely to be a true hypersensitivity or allergy.


Systemic impacts are rather different from topical impacts. They typically happen far from the initial point of contact as a result of the chemical being taken in into and distributed throughout the body. Systemic results commonly include nausea, throwing up, fatigue, headache, and digestive disorders. In innovative poisoning situations, the person may experience modifications in heart rate, difficulty breathing, convulsions, and coma, which can bring about fatality.
